Below is the JAMB subject combination for Yoruba in the Faculty of Arts and Humanities:
- English Language
- Yoruba
- Government or Economics (accepted)
- Any other art subject
Requirements to Study Yoruba in Nigeria:
- To commence Yoruba studies in Nigeria, you must have a minimum of five (5) credits at the O’Level (WAEC or NECO), including English and Mathematics, in not more than two (2) sittings. However, some schools may require a single sitting.
- By the end of October in the year of admission, you must have reached the age of sixteen (16).
- Attain the Yoruba cutoff score required by your chosen university.
- Possess strong results from JAMB, WAEC, and any post-UTME examinations.
Direct Entry Requirements to Study Yoruba in Nigeria:
- A maximum of two (2) sittings with a minimum of five (5) credits in the Senior Secondary Certificate Examinations (SSCE/GCE).
- Hold a degree in a related discipline with a First Class or Second Class Upper.
- Direct entry candidates must obtain the Direct Entry form from the Joint Admissions and Matriculation Board (JAMB).
- Possess an Advanced Level Certificate with a minimum Merit Pass in the National Certificate of Education (NCE), National Diploma (ND), or any relevant Advanced Level Certificate.
- Any additional qualifications equivalent to the requirements stated in points (1) and (4) above, and accepted by the Senate of the chosen university. Candidates must also meet the Faculty/Departmental entry requirements in addition to the minimum admission requirements mentioned above.
List of Universities Offering Yoruba Studies:
- Adekunle Ajasin University, Akungba-Akoko, Ondo State – AAUA
- Ekiti State University, Ado-Ekiti, Ekiti State – EKSU
- Fountain University, Osogbo, Osun State – FOUNTAIN
- University of Ibadan, Ibadan, Oyo State – IBADAN
- University of Ilorin, Ilorin, Kwara State – ILORIN
- Kwara State University, Malete, Ilorin, Kwara State – KWASU
- University of Lagos, Lagos State – LAGOS
- Nigerian Army University, Biu, Borno State – NAUB
- Obafemi Awolowo University, Ile-Ife, Osun State – OAU
- Olabisi Onabanjo University, Ago-Iwoye, Ogun State – OOU
- Nigerian Police Academy, Wudil, Kano State – POL-ACAD
- Osun State University, Osogbo, Osun State – UNIOSUN
